onThe greatness/grossness of the USDA Food Safety and Inspection Service email updates is indisputable (remember our old friends Class II Recall of Frozen Cattle Heads That Contain Prohibited Materials and Hot Beef Carcasses?). Now the USDA is being good enough to tell you WHERE the food with E. coli, Listeria, botulism, “undeclared allergens,” mislabeling, and good old “adulteration” is being sold, so if you got some, you might have a clue about it. (Or, if you didn’t get some, maybe you still could!)
The latest recall is from Nestlé, involving approximately 215,660 pounds of pepperoni HOT POCKETS® that “may contain [unspecified but presumably undelicious] foreign materials” (“The problem was discovered after the company received consumer complaints”).
Where can you get some?
Wal-Mart Stores & Wal-Mart Supercenters, Natiionwide [sic]Ramey’s, Various locations in Mississippi
Easy Way Stores, Memphis TN [love the name!]
Superlo Foods, Memphis TN [ditto; my new band’s name]
…and in more convenient Southern locations.
You may sign up for the USDA FSIS emails here. As with HOT POCKETS®, you’ll “Get more of what you’re hungry for”!
